Ayesha McGowan (she/they) is a pioneering professional road cyclist and a leading advocate for diversity, equity, and inclusion in the sport. Now retired, she was the first ever African-American woman pro road cyclist in the world, and is still using her platform to inspire and create pathways for others.

Thee Abundance Project

With workshops, skills clinics, and more, Thee Abundance Project is dedicated to creating more confident road bike riders and racers of color. In time we hope we’ll see more women of color racing in the pro peloton.
